Abstract EN
The genes coded and referred to as 18S rDNA has been selected as a universal marker.
Sequence data from 18S rDNA was used to estimate the genetic variants on 128 rabbits belonging to five different breeds in Egypt, New Zealand White (NZW, n = 35), California (Ca, n = 35), Chinchilla (C, n = 19), Flander (F, n = 19) and Babion (B, n = 20).
Blood samples for sequencing were collected and sequence diversity diagram for multiple sequence alignments was performed.
In addition, the comparative analysis according to detected SNPs was implemented.
The results revealed that a 1115 bp fragment of DNA sequence was constructed using ABI5100 automated sequencer.
Random small DNA sequence mismatches (74 nucleotides ; 1-29, 1071-1115) has been detected.
The similarity between Ca and NZW breeds was 92 %, additionally, higher similarity percentage was observed between C and both of B, and F (97.02, 97.5 respectively).
Nine SNPs were detected; five single nucleotide polymorphisms w e re s p re a d t o (SNP : A > T, and T > A) for B and F located at 185, and 508 bp, also C > A and G > C for C located at 268, and 919 bp.
In addition, A > T for B located at 267 bp, and four SNPs between Ca and NZW located at 880, 886, 899, and 900 bp were detected.
The Maximum Likelihood was used to estimate the Transition/Transversion (ti / tv) Bias resulted in the estimated (ti / tv) bias (R) was 0.67.
Substitution pattern and rates were estimated, the nucleotide frequencies were A = 22.12%, T / U = 21.13 %, C = 26.72 %, and G = 29.99 %.
In conclusion, the utilized five rabbit breeds possess a good reservoir for diversity which is essential for genetic improvement.
Formal conservation plan is needed and must be implemented in Egypt to achieve such proper genetic improvement.
